titleOfInvention Preparation of water repellent film
abstract PURPOSE:To obtain the titled soft, porous film for rain coat and the like by a method wherein vinyl chloride resin powder being dispersed in water along with plasticizer, water repellent is applied to the base material with surface releasability to form a coating film and the film is heated, melted then cooled. CONSTITUTION:A hundred weight parts of vinyl chloride resin powder are dispersed in water along with 20-80 weight parts of plasticizer (such as dioctylphthalate etc.) and 0.1-10 weight parts of repellent (such as silicone emulsion etc.), then, this dispersion liquid is applied to a base having surface peeling properties (such as release paper etc.) to form a coating film. The base provided with this coating film is heated in a hot stove etc. water is volatiled, particle surface of polyvinyl chloride resin powder is melted, neighboring particle surfaces stick to one another, then, cooled to obtain the desired film.
